Report: Manchester United Signs Blackburn Defender Phil Jones in £16 Million Deal

by

Jun 8, 2011

After being beaten out by Liverpool for Sunderland midfielder Jordan Henderson, Sir Alex Ferguson returned the favor on Wednesday, signing Liverpool target Phil Jones of the Blackburn Rovers.

The £16 million deal comes just one month after the 19-year-old versatile defender signed a five-year deal to stay at Ewood Park, according to the Guardian.

Jones, who is part of England's Under-21 squad heading to Denmark for the European Championships, made his Premier League debut in 2010.
